The Fire Risk Officer will liaise with external bodies such as Primary Fire Authority, contractors, consultants, Local Authorities, and other Associations, ensuring that regular inspections are carried out on all dwellings and buildings with common areas, undertaking fire risk assessments according to PAS 79.
You’ll work across the South and South West of England, with monthly travel to London, providing expert fire safety advice and ensuring compliance with the Regulatory Reform (Fire Safety) Order 2005. To be successful in this role, they will need to have experience in carrying out fire risk inspections and producing reports. As well as substantial knowledge and ability to act in role encompassing fire risk assessment and fire safety within a housing environment.
What You'll Be Doing
* Ensure that regular inspections are carried out on all Group dwellings and buildings with common areas, undertaking fire risk assessments according to PAS 79.
* Audit and review of 3rd party fire risk assessments undertaken by contractors.
* Periodically review the fire risk assessments and maintain a database of assessments for examination by and distribution to all interested parties.
* Assist with fire specifications as and when required for works in conjunction with AM&M.
* With the Fire Safety Manager, to act as a contact with the groups Primary Fire Authority Partner (Currently Dorset & Wiltshire Fire & Rescue)
* Ensure that the priority matrix timescales are adhered to by issuing programmes of fire safety work to the planned delivery teams and in accordance with allotted budgets.
* Ensure that all relevant fire safety information is accessible for the Group’s common areas, schemes and HMOs.
* Work with the Primary Authority and colleagues following any fire related incident, to investigate, understand and communicate learning outcomes.
* Provide reports and statistics as required to relevant health & safety panels or groups such as Fire Safety Action Group (FSAG).
What We’re Looking For
Essential:
* Substantial Demonstrable experience in construction/ fire safety industry
* A minimum of two years’ experience in carrying out fire risk inspections and producing reports
* Substantial knowledge and ability to act in roles encompassing fire risk assessment and fire safety within a Housing environment
* Significant understanding of the importance of value for money and efficiency.
* Substantial experience of researching and developing fire safety policies, procedures and guidance
Desirable:
* Some experience of affordable housing
* Significant experience of producing formal reports for Board and other meetings
Education, Vocational Training & Qualifications
* NEBOSH General Certificate or equivalent.
* Fire Safety and Fire Risk Assessment training (Institute of Fire Engineers or equivalent)
* Asbestos training, knowledge and/or experience
* Accredited Domestic Energy Assessor
